An analysis of ELF sferics produced by rocket-triggered lightning

2014 XXXIth URSI General Assembly and Scientific Symposium (URSI GASS), 2014
Lightning regularly generates ELF radio atmospherics (sferics) in the 5–500 Hz frequency range. The processes that produce ELF sferics have been studied for more than 50 years. Rocket-triggered lightning experiments at the International Center for Lightning Research and Testing (ICLRT) located at Camp Blanding, Florida provide a unique data set for ...

An experimental study of positive leaders initiating rocket-triggered lightning

Atmospheric Research, 1999
Abstract Simultaneous, co-located measurements of ambient, electrostatic-field profiles and rocket-triggered lightning phenomenology beneath Florida thunderstorms are reported. Ambient-field conditions that are sufficient to initiate and sustain the propagation of positive lightning leaders are identified.
